What type of ship is this?

IKAMBA (IMO 8529911) is a /Trans-shipment ship built in 2011 and is sailing under the flag of Panama. She has an overall length (LOA) of 132 meters and a width (beam) of 35 meters. Her summer deadweight capacity is unknown.
